Beau Vernon suffered a spinal cord injury whilst playing Australian Rules Football in 2012, leaving him a quadriplegic! Any spinal cord injury can have disastrous effects, in Beau’s case, the injury has randomly affected so many of his normal bodily functions and movements, that it’s hard to grasp and understand what he has had to deal with and overcome!
 
His story over the past 6 years is amazing, inspiring and enlightening, so much that you will want to cry, laugh and wonder at what one determined man can achieve against such odds!
